Auxiliary Equipment:
6.1 Doorphone Programming
Up to 2 extensions can be specified as being doorphone extensions. When a person uses one of these doorphone
extensions, it signals a set of doorphone alert extensions that you can specify.
To use the doorphone functionality, program the following features:
· Doorphone Extension
Identify the extensions to which the doorphones are connected.
· Doorphone Alert Extensions
Identify which extensions should be alerted when a doorphone button is pressed.
6.1.1 Doorphone Extensions
Use these features to identify an extension to which a doorphone is connected. A doorphone is usually placed near an
entrance, to screen visitors. You can connect up to two doorphones to the system.
· The same extension cannot be assigned as an internal hotline extension and a door phone extension. Assigning
a door phone extension as an internal hotline extension cancels the door phone setting.
· You should not assign extensions 10 and 11 as doorphones.
· Switch off VMS coverage for the extension assigned as a doorphone extension.
· To prevent outside calls from being made or received on the doorphone, use Line Assignment to remove all
outside lines from the doorphone extension.
· Automatic Line Selection for an extension assigned as a doorphone extension is automatically set to select
intercom lines first.
To set a doorphone extension (ETR 18D/34D)
1.At a system administration extension (10 and 11); with the phone idle press Feature 0 0 followed by two presses
of Intercom 1. System Administration: is shown on the display.
2.Dial #604 for doorphone 1 or #605 for doorphone 2. The phone displays Doorphone 1 Extension or
Doorphone 2 Extension respectively.
3.At the Extension: prompt enter the doorphone two-digit extension number or press Remove to unassign an
existing doorphone extension.
· Exit programming by pressing Feature 00. You can also exit programming mode by lifting the handset, then place
it back in the cradle.
To set a doorphone extension (1408/1416 Phone)
1.At either of the system administration telephones (extensions 10 and 11), with the phone idle press Admin.
2.Use the up or down arrow buttons to scroll the display to System Administration. When displayed, press
Select.
3.Use the up or down arrow buttons to scroll the display to Auxiliary Equipment. When displayed, press
Select.
· Alternatively, dial # and the same code as used by ETR phones for system administration .
4.Use the up or down arrow buttons to scroll the display to Doorphone 1 Extension or Doorphone 2
Extension. When displayed, press Select.
5.The current setting is displayed.
6.At the Extension: prompt enter the extension number of the doorphone extension. Alternatively use the left or
right arrow icons to toggle through the settings or Clear to return to the default setting (no doorphone).
· Exit programming by pressing PHONE/EXIT. Alternatively use the Back button to move to another menu.
